Super Heavy hobby challenge 2016

Hi guys.

Next year Aaron and myself are looking at buying ourselves a Warhound titan each and both constructing a sweet diorama/display to show it off.

I was thinking we could do it as a group challenge if any of you are also keen.

For guidelines I was thinking the following :-

1. Must be a Super Heavy or Gargantuan Creature

2. Must be on a 2ft x 2ft display base (Realm of Battle tile size)

3. Must have some friendly support troops, and at least 1 enemy model

4. Must have some form of terrain included in display

For example, my board will involve a scene in the HH novel Betrayer where the Warhound supporting the World Eaters is advancing with the Astartes. It will have Kharn and his command squad as a secondary feature and also some Ultramarines making their final stand.

And I think Aaron was looking at doing a Nurgle themed Warhound with some Deathguard / Plaguebearers in a swampy shithole.

This is obviously meant as a large, long term project, hence the massive scale, so it may not appeal to all.

As usual, I am trying to expand my skill horizon.  These grots have had a black prime, deathworld forest base, biel-tan green wash, and then the skill test.  Rather than dry brush on the next layer, I have attempted to do like highlight stuffs, or whatever its called.  Not getting the recesses, and paint the raised surface.
